  • 2Sandeep Biswas

    We had signed up 3 kids for a 3 day beginners surf class which we split across Sanur on 2 days and Kuta on the third day. Overall, the quality of the coaching was very good, especially at Sanur and the kids loved it. A couple of the instructors (at Kuta) got mixed feedback from the kids. The facilities at Sanur are very good, but at Kuta this was not true - the changing area and showering facilities were rather poor. Overall though, the kids had a great time and enjoyed the experience. The reason for my low rating is a safety incident that happened on day 3, when the Rip Curl van was bringing us to the surf venue from our hotel; the driver was falling asleep at the wheel. For a long time he was driving extremely slowly with cars overtaking us on both sides. At one point he drove off the road - luckily I was sitting next to him at the front and had my eyes peeled to the road and managed to quickly take control of the steering wheel and got the van back on the road.
